- Jack T. McNutt: Newspaper Obituary and Death Notice--Times-Courier (Charleston, IL) - Thursday, June 10, 2010
CHARLESTON - 'Jack T. McNutt, 95, of Charleston, passed away June 8, 2010 at Sarah Bush Lincoln Health Center, Mattoon. The funeral service honoring his life will be held atWesley United Methodist Church, 2206 4th Street, Charleston, with Reverend Walter Carlson and Pastor Jerry Sweeney officiating. Interment will follow in Roselawn Cemetery, Charleston. Masonic Rites. Jack was born November 24, 1914 in Coles County, Illinois, son of John Raymond and Alia (Glasgow) McNutt. He married June Featherston March 20, 1938 at the First Christian Church Parsonage, Charleston, by Reverend R.L. Hayes; she preceded him into Heaven, July 4, 1967. He later married Reata Lacy, December 28, 1971 at Trinity Presbyterian Church, Tucson, AZ; she survives. Also surviving is one son: James L. McNutt, Sr. and wife Sabina of Charleston; one daughter: Lynn Cunningham and husband Gary of Pontiac, IL; three grandchildren: Toni M. McNutt of Charleston, James L. McNutt, Jr. of Kannapolis, NC, and Rae Ann Woodrow of Indianapolis, IN. Eight great-grandchildren: Casey, Madeline, Olivia, Gavin, Kendra, Payton, Natalia, and Maya; and one great-great-grandchild: Candice Jane, also survive. In addition to his first wife, he was preceded in death by one daughter: Judith Kaye (McNutt) Samuelson; one granddaughter: Kendra Lynne (Cunningham) Patton; and one sister: Elizabeth Jane (McNutt) Krajefska. Jack was a lifelong farmer, having farmed with his own father for 70 years. He was a member of Wesley United Methodist Church and was a 32nd Degree Master Mason, having been inducted into Charleston Masonic Lodge 35 January 22, 1952.'
